Hello, I am having issues with playing games on my Fedora system. I have Nvidia GPU (3060) with proprietary drivers installed. The problem is that although my GPU is fully utilized, it only produces around 30-35 fps in linux native games and around 40-45 fps with Proton enabled.
I am running Fedora 44 (Gnome, Wayland), 32 GB RAM, Intel i7-12700H and the mentioned RTX 3060 GPU. It’s also a laptop.
Here are some outputs from Hollow Knight: Silksong running as linux native game:
Game itself:

Output from nvidia-smi:
Sat May 16 14:11:56 2026
+-----------------------------------------------------------------------------------------+
| NVIDIA-SMI 595.71.05 Driver Version: 595.71.05 CUDA Version: 13.2 |
+-----------------------------------------+------------------------+----------------------+
| GPU Name Persistence-M | Bus-Id Disp.A | Volatile Uncorr. ECC |
| Fan Temp Perf Pwr:Usage/Cap | Memory-Usage | GPU-Util Compute M. |
| | | MIG M. |
|=========================================+========================+======================|
| 0 NVIDIA GeForce RTX 3060 ... Off | 00000000:01:00.0 Off | N/A |
| N/A 68C P0 66W / 138W | 2475MiB / 6144MiB | 100% Default |
| | | N/A |
+-----------------------------------------+------------------------+----------------------+
+-----------------------------------------------------------------------------------------+
| Processes: |
| GPU GI CI PID Type Process name GPU Memory |
| ID ID Usage |
|=========================================================================================|
| 0 N/A N/A 4774 G /usr/bin/gnome-shell 2MiB |
| 0 N/A N/A 20164 G ...share/Steam/ubuntu12_32/steam 4MiB |
| 0 N/A N/A 20421 G ./steamwebhelper 113MiB |
| 0 N/A N/A 20456 G ...am/ubuntu12_64/steamwebhelper 295MiB |
| 0 N/A N/A 24436 G C:\windows\system32\explorer.exe 2MiB |
| 0 N/A N/A 24462 C+G ...ng\Hollow Knight Silksong.exe 1957MiB |
+-----------------------------------------------------------------------------------------+
I can provide more information if needed.